how did markus granlund and lindhbom never turn into good NHLers? both are very good and have physical strenght

I'd say not efficient enough in the offensive end. It doesn't leave a lasting impression in the NHL if you don't have any big strengths and you are just well rounded. More good examples of this are guys like Mäenalanen, Suomela (back then didn't score enough), Pakarinen and the list goes on.

Wrong skating style, would need to move his feet more. Pakarinen however.. I cannot understand how he doesn't score more in Europe and why he isn't a fourth liner in the NHL. Looks brilliant on the national team. Always looks pretty darn skilled and strong. Can play some D too.

Fourth liner types or bottom liners are just not very valued in the NHL. Hartikainen in Europe now is more of a top-6 guy, but back in the NHL he wasn't efficient enough scorer and as you said, skating. Fourth liners come and they go, unless they have a special skill/ability. It's also about salary cap things. It's just so easy to replace them and at the same time teams want to give a look for younger players and see their NHL potential.
